Are you a beginner looking to seamlessly export MySQL data to Excel without encountering technical obstacles? This article is tailored just for you. In this concise guide, we will walk you through simple steps to effortlessly transfer your MySQL data to Excel format, enabling you to analyze, manipulate, and present your data in a user-friendly manner.
Understanding the process of exporting MySQL data to Excel is a valuable skill to possess, especially in today’s data-driven world. By following the straightforward instructions outlined in this quick guide, you will equip yourself with a practical and essential tool for effectively managing your data and unlocking valuable insights.
Install A Mysql Database Management Tool
To export MySQL data to Excel, the first step is to install a MySQL database management tool on your computer. These tools provide a user-friendly interface to interact with your MySQL database and run queries efficiently. Popular MySQL database management tools include phpMyAdmin, MySQL Workbench, and SQLyog.
Installing a MySQL management tool is essential as it allows you to connect to your MySQL database, view tables, and execute SQL queries to extract data. These tools often come with built-in features that make exporting data to Excel seamless, such as the ability to export query results directly to a CSV file format, which can then be opened in Excel.
By installing a MySQL database management tool, you’ll have a centralized platform to manage and manipulate your MySQL data, streamlining the process of exporting data to Excel. Additionally, these tools offer various functionalities that can assist you in organizing, analyzing, and exporting your data with ease, making them a valuable asset for both beginners and experienced users alike.
Connect To Your Mysql Database
To begin the process of exporting MySQL data to Excel, the first step is to establish a connection to your MySQL database. You can do this by using a database management tool such as phpMyAdmin or MySQL Workbench. These tools provide a user-friendly interface that allows you to connect to your database by entering the necessary credentials such as the hostname, username, password, and database name.
Once you have successfully connected to your MySQL database, you can start accessing the tables and data within it. It is essential to ensure that you have the required permissions to read from the database in order to export the data. You can verify this by checking your user privileges or consulting with your database administrator.
Having established a connection and verified your permissions, you are now ready to proceed with exporting your MySQL data to Excel. This initial step of connecting to your MySQL database is crucial as it sets the foundation for the subsequent steps involved in the data export process.
Query And Export Data In Mysql
To query and export data in MySQL, you can use the SELECT statement with the INTO OUTFILE clause. First, construct your desired query to select the data you want to export from your database. Include any necessary conditions or filters to refine your results. Once your query is finalized, add the INTO OUTFILE clause followed by the file path where you want to save the exported data.
Ensure that the file path is accessible and that the MySQL server has the necessary permissions to write to that location. Additionally, specify the format of the output file, such as CSV or Excel, by adding appropriate file extensions or formatting options. Execute the query in your chosen MySQL client, and the data will be exported to the specified file location in the format you specified. This process allows you to extract data from your MySQL database and save it in a user-friendly format for further analysis or sharing.
Import Data Into Excel
To import data into Excel from MySQL, you can utilize the ‘Data’ tab in Excel. Click on ‘Data’ and then select ‘Get Data’ > ‘From Database’ > ‘From MySQL Database’. Input the necessary server details, including the server name, database name, and the authentication method to connect to your MySQL database. Once connected, choose the tables or views you want to import into Excel.
Next, Excel will prompt you to select how you want to view this data – either as a Table or PivotTable. Choose the desired option and click ‘Load’ to bring the MySQL data into Excel. You can then refresh this data in Excel whenever needed to reflect the most recent information stored in your MySQL database.
After importing the data, you can manipulate and analyze it using Excel tools such as formulas, charts, and graphs. This allows you to gain insights, create reports, and visualize the MySQL data easily within Excel. Remember to save your Excel file to retain the imported MySQL data for future reference or analysis.
Utilize Export Settings In Excel
To ensure a successful export of MySQL data to Excel, it is crucial to utilize the export settings in Excel effectively. When exporting data, Excel provides various options to customize the format and layout of the data being imported. One key setting to consider is the delimiter selection, which allows users to specify how data should be separated within the Excel sheet.
Additionally, utilizing the text qualifier setting can help in properly formatting data fields that contain special characters or spaces. This setting ensures that data is accurately transferred and displayed in Excel without any loss of information. It is important to review and adjust these export settings based on the specific requirements of the MySQL data being exported, to ensure a seamless transfer process.
Furthermore, Excel offers advanced options for handling data types, headers, and other formatting elements during the export process. By exploring and making use of these export settings effectively, users can optimize the Excel spreadsheet layout and presentation of the MySQL data, making it easier to analyze and work with the information once it is imported into Excel.
Apply Data Formatting In Excel
In Excel, applying data formatting is crucial to ensure that your exported MySQL data is presented clearly and professionally. By using features such as formatting numbers, dates, and text, you can enhance the readability and visual appeal of your dataset. Excel offers various formatting options like currency, percentage, date formats, and text alignment, allowing you to customize the appearance of your data according to your preferences.
To apply data formatting in Excel, simply select the cells or columns you want to format, then navigate to the ‘Home’ tab and choose the appropriate formatting options from the toolbar. You can adjust the font size, color, style, and add borders to highlight specific data points. It’s essential to maintain consistency in formatting throughout your spreadsheet to ensure a cohesive presentation and make it easier for your audience to interpret the information.
Remember that data formatting in Excel is not permanent and can be easily modified or undone as needed. Experiment with different formatting styles to find the best fit for your MySQL data and create a polished Excel sheet that effectively conveys your insights to your audience.
Automate Data Export Using Scripts
Automating data export using scripts can greatly streamline the process of exporting MySQL data to Excel. By writing scripts, you can programmatically control the export parameters, scheduling, and execution of the data export process. This helps in reducing manual effort and ensures consistency in the exported data format.
Scripts can be written in languages like Python, Bash, or even SQL itself to automate the export process. You can create scripts to connect to the MySQL database, execute queries to fetch data, format the data as needed, and save it directly to an Excel file. By setting up scheduled tasks or cron jobs to run these scripts at specified intervals, you can ensure that your Excel files are regularly updated with the latest MySQL data without any manual intervention.
Automation through scripts also allows for error handling and logging, making it easier to monitor the export process and troubleshoot any issues that may arise. With a well-written script in place, you can save time, reduce the chances of human error, and have a more efficient MySQL to Excel data export workflow.
Troubleshooting Common Export Issues
In case you encounter issues during the MySQL data export to Excel process, it is essential to have troubleshooting strategies at hand. One common problem is data formatting inconsistencies between MySQL and Excel, leading to irregularities in the exported file. To address this, ensure that the data types in MySQL align with the corresponding formats in Excel to avoid any data distortion.
Furthermore, if you face challenges with large datasets causing slow export speeds, consider optimizing your MySQL queries by utilizing indexed columns and limiting the number of selected rows for export. Additionally, breaking down the export into smaller segments can help enhance performance and prevent system crashes or timeouts during the process.
Lastly, if you experience any unexpected errors or failures during the export, check the server logs for detailed error messages that can pinpoint the root cause. It is advisable to review your MySQL configuration settings, update the export tool you are using, or seek assistance from online communities or technical support to troubleshoot and resolve any persistent export issues effectively.
FAQs
What Tools Or Software Do I Need To Export Mysql Data To Excel?
To export MySQL data to Excel, you can use tools like MySQL Workbench, Navicat, or HeidiSQL. These tools allow you to run SQL queries and export query results directly to Excel format. Additionally, you can use MySQL’s built-in command-line tool or PHPMyAdmin to export MySQL data to CSV format, which can be easily opened in Excel for further manipulation and analysis.
Can I Export Specific Tables Or Queries From Mysql To Excel?
Yes, you can export specific tables or queries from MySQL to Excel by using the MySQL Workbench tool. First, run the query or select the table data you want to export in MySQL Workbench. Then, right-click on the result set and choose the “Export” option. Select the desired format (such as CSV) and save the file. You can then open the exported file in Excel. Alternatively, you can use the command-line tool mysqldump to export data from specific tables or queries into a file that can be imported into Excel.
Is There A Step-By-Step Guide Available For Exporting Mysql Data To Excel?
Yes, there are step-by-step guides available online for exporting MySQL data to Excel. One common approach is to first use SQL queries to retrieve the data you want to export from MySQL, then save the results as a CSV (Comma Separated Values) file. You can then open the CSV file in Excel and save it in XLS or XLSX format if needed. Many tutorials provide detailed instructions on each step of this process, making it easy to export MySQL data to Excel.
Are There Any Limitations Or Considerations To Keep In Mind When Exporting Mysql Data To Excel?
When exporting MySQL data to Excel, consider the limitations of Excel’s row and column constraints. Large datasets may not fully export or could cause performance issues. Additionally, complex data types in MySQL, such as JSON or binary data, may not be fully supported or easily translated into Excel. Be mindful of data formatting discrepancies between MySQL and Excel, which could lead to data loss or errors during the export process.
How Can I Ensure Data Integrity And Accuracy When Transferring Mysql Data To Excel?
To ensure data integrity and accuracy when transferring MySQL data to Excel, you can export the data directly from MySQL into Excel using the ‘Export’ function in MySQL Workbench or by writing a query to retrieve the data in the desired format. Ensure that the data types in MySQL and Excel match to prevent any loss or corruption of data during the transfer process. You can also validate the data after the transfer by comparing a sample of records between MySQL and Excel to confirm accuracy. Regularly updating the data transfer process and performing data validation checks will help maintain data integrity throughout the transfer operation.
Final Words
Exporting MySQL data to Excel may seem daunting for beginners, but with the simple steps outlined in this guide, the process becomes more manageable and straightforward. By following these steps carefully, you can efficiently transfer your data from MySQL to Excel without any unnecessary complications. This quick guide provides a solid foundation for those new to exporting data, empowering them to harness the power of these two essential tools effectively.
As you familiarize yourself with the process, remember to practice and explore additional features to enhance your data export capabilities. With patience and persistence, you will soon master the art of exporting MySQL data to Excel, opening up a world of possibilities for analyzing and manipulating your data efficiently.